**Ember Korowai Takitini**:
Ember Korowai Takitini are leaders in The Peer & Lived Experience mental health and addiction sector, dedicated to providing comprehensive and compassionate care to individuals experiencing mental health challenges. Our Peer & Lived Experience services blends professional expertise and lived experience to offer a range of services and supports for anyone with mental health, addiction, or intellectual disability needs.

We are seeking a Team Manager to lead a new service established to embed Peer Support Specialist within allocated Te Whatu Ora Te Toka Tumai Auckland Kahui o te Ihi clinical services. These services are:

- ** (1) Kari Centre**

**(a) Aronui Ora **(Maternal mental health) (1FTE)

**(b) Hāpai Ora **(Early Psychosis Service) (1FTE)
- ** (2) Manawanui **(Māori mental health) (2FTE)
- **(3) Lotofale **(Pacific mental health) (2FTE)

**The Service**:
As a Peer Support Specialist Team manager, you will play a pivotal role in supporting, leading and co-ordinating Peer Support Specialists embedded in selective clinical services. You will work collaboratively with three multidisciplinary teams of mental health professionals, ensuring a holistic and person-centred approach to care.

**Role**:
As the Team Manager for our Peer Support Specialist Service, you will play a vital role in overseeing the day-to-day operations of the program. Your primary responsibility will be to lead and support a team of Peer Support Specialists, ensuring the delivery of high-quality services to our clients.

**Responsibilities**:

- Provide strong leadership, guidance, and supervision to a team of Peer Support Specialists.
- Develop and implement program policies, procedures, and guidelines in collaboration with the team.
- Recruit, train, and onboard new Peer Support Specialists.
- Conduct regular performance evaluations and provide ongoing coaching and feedback to team members.
- Foster a positive and inclusive team culture that encourages personal growth, collaboration, and mutual support.
- Collaborate with other departments and stakeholders to ensure effective coordination of services.
- Monitor program outcomes, collect data, and prepare reports to evaluate program effectiveness.
- Stay updated on best practices and emerging trends in peer support services.

**Qualifications**:

- Bachelor's degree in a related field (e.g., psychology, social work, counseling) or equivalent work experience.
- Proven experience in managing teams and overseeing program operations.
- Knowledge of peer support principles and practices.
- Familiarity with mental health challenges and recovery-oriented approaches.
- Strong inter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to build rapport and work effectively with individuals from diverse backgrounds.
- Excellent organizational and time management abilities.
- Ability to handle confidential information with sensitivity and maintain professional boundaries.
- Proficient computer skills for documentation and data management purposes.
- Demonstrated commitment to ongoing personal and professional growth.
- Full NZ Drivers Licence
- Valid/Current work visa, residency, or citizenship
